Produktbeschreibung
When thinking about energy efficiency, one of the most important decisions to be made regarding a new home is the type of heating and cooling system to install. Equally critical to consider is the selection of the heating and cooling contractor. The operating efficiency of a system depends as much on proper installation as it does on the performance rating of the equipment. By playing with the physical concepts of hot and cold air assisted with technological control schemes, we are able to perform the ventilation in the most optimal methodology available. The main objective is to minimize the energy consumption by shifting towards a proposed system using the concept of IOT, controller automation and mathematical data analysis. The need for automated temperature control is increasing day by day with smart and effective control methods. This project proposes to automate and increase efficiency of temperature control using regression model algorithms in the air-conditioned coaches of the Railways and other enclosed environments to provide optimum temperatures for comfortable travel to passengers with minimal human-machine contact.
